## Changelog — RateLens 3.2

Defaults changed for the parity checker. Crawl interval shortened, stale-quote tolerance tightened, and the Brightmoor sandbox endpoint is no longer the fallback. New hires: these defaults apply to all fresh installs; existing deployments keep their overrides. Rollback requires pinning 3.1 explicitly. The new default configuration shipped with this release is shown below.

config for kafof-bawef:
holath:
  log_level: debug
  metrics_host: metrics.holath.qorvelsys.internal
  pin: 2191
  pool_size: 32

Internal Memo — Training Budget, Next Year (Marwick & Lowe Retail Group)

Branch managers: next year's training budget is set at the same nominal level as this year, which means a modest real-terms reduction. Priority goes to compliance modules and the new Ledgerpoint till system rollout. Discretionary external courses require regional sign-off. Submit branch training plans by end of November. Allocations will be confirmed in December. The following confidential note outlines how training fits into broader plans.

board note of bawep-tajef: Queniusek Systems plans to raise the Quenvan list price by 53.1 percent in March. The pricing group signed off on a budget of $176.4 million for Project Drueth. The renewal with Casionix Partners closes at $142.5 million a year, 8.3 percent below the last contract. Project Fraax slips by six weeks because of the tooling delay.

Action item (from the Glyphfall outage postmortem): vendor all third-party fonts used by the Caldera UI instead of loading them from the remote Typeslate CDN. The outage showed that a CDN failure blanks headings across three products. Owner: Priya on the platform team; target is end of next sprint. Scope includes license review, checksum pinning, and a CI check that fails builds referencing external font hosts. Progress tracking, the approved font list, and the vendoring procedure live on the internal page.

operations page: https://jira.qirvansys.internal/display/dash/dash/2ffa8a097d16